The world’s most powerful rocket, SpaceX’s Falcon Heavy, blasts off from Cape Canaveral in February carrying Elon Musk’s Tesla Roadster and a dummy named Starman. But soon it could deploy thousands of satellites to enable broadband around the world, following deployment approval from the FCC in March for the NGSO satellite system.
